Custard vs. Buckwheat — In-Depth Nutrition Comparison

Compare

Significant differences between custard and buckwheat

  • Custard is richer in vitamin B12, vitamin B2, calcium, and phosphorus, while buckwheat is higher in manganese, copper, fiber, and magnesium.
  • Custard covers your daily vitamin B12 needs 22% more than buckwheat.
  • Buckwheat has a higher glycemic index (51) than custard (35).

Specific food types used in this comparison are Egg custards, dry mix, prepared with whole milk and Buckwheat groats, roasted, cooked.
